Subject: Partner SFTP drop — new owner

Hi,

As you review the pending changes to the Harborline ingest scripts, note that ownership of the partner SFTP drop is changing at the end of the month. This includes key rotation, the nightly pull job, and the quarantine folder for malformed files. Review comments on the retry logic should still go through the normal PR flow, but questions about drop-folder conventions or partner onboarding now go to the new owner. The incoming owner is listed below.

signatory, tagaf-bahaf: Praael Fenmir Rusok

Heads up, plugin folks: if your CI runs against the Quellbrook profile store, you may have hit the shard migration we rolled out this week. User profiles are now split across four shards by account hash, so any plugin that assumed a single connection string will fail during integration tests. Update your fixtures to use the shard-aware client from the Quellbrook SDK, version 3.2 or later. If tests still flake after that, grab the trace token from the failing job and attach it below.

session token of fahap-hawip = htk31_7852f2b3276dba2738f98fa97f92237

Capacity note for the Bramblewick export retry queue. Failed exports are requeued with exponential backoff, and the queue depth is our main capacity signal: sustained depth above the high-water mark means downstream Pellis storage is saturated, not that we need more workers. As the new contractor, please don't raise worker counts without checking storage latency first — it usually makes things worse. Retry timing, backoff caps, and the high-water threshold are all driven by the constants shown below.

limits module of yagef-bajog:
TIERS = {
    "druael": 370,
    "tamix": 286,
    "pelius": 541,
    "pelael": 78,
    "pelox": 47,
    "ralath": 533,
    "drumir": 801,
}

### Step 4: Configure the rollout service

Almost there. Before Flagpole can start serving flag evaluations, its env file needs the core settings: FLAGPOLE_ENV (staging or prod), FLAGPOLE_ROLLOUT_MODE (use "percentage" unless the feature owners asked for cohorts), and FLAGPOLE_SYNC_INTERVAL (keep the default 30s for launch day). Double-check the mode — a typo here and every flag evaluates to off, which makes for a very quiet release party. Last thing: the admin API needs its signing secret, which goes on the very next line:

sealed setting: ARCHIVE_KEY3=8d0